Amazon cover image
Image from Amazon.com

Programming languages : principles and practice / Kenneth C. Louden, Kenneth A. Lambert.

By: Contributor(s): Material type: TextTextPublication details: Boston, Massachusetts : Course Technology Cengage Learning, c2012Edition: Third editionDescription: ix, 662 pages : illustrations ; 24 cmISBN:
  • 9781111529413
Subject(s): LOC classification:
  • QA 76.7 .L68 2012
Contents:
Introduction -- Language design criteria -- Functional programming -- Logic programming -- Object-oriented programming -- Syntax -- Basic semantics -- Data types -- Control I -- Expressions and statements -- Control II -- Procedures and environments -- Abstract data types and modules -- Formal semantics -- Parallel programming.
Summary: "Kenneth Louden and Kenneth Lambert's new edition of Programming languages: principles and practice gives advanced undergraduate students an overview of programming languages through general principles combined with details about many modern languages. Major languages used in this edition include C, C++, Smalltalk, Java, Ada, ML, Haskell, Scheme, and Prolog; many other languages are discussed more briefly. The text also contains extensive coverage of implementation issues, the theoretical foundations of programming languages, and a large number of exercises, making it the perfect bridge to compiler courses and to the theoretical study of programming languages."--Publisher's description."
Item type: Books
Tags from this library: No tags from this library for this title. Log in to add tags.
Star ratings
    Average rating: 0.0 (0 votes)
Holdings
Item type Current library Home library Collection Call number Copy number Status Date due Barcode
Books Books National University - Manila LRC - Main General Circulation Computer Science GC QA 76.7 .L68 2012 (Browse shelf(Opens below)) c.1 Available NULIB000006712

Includes bibliographical references (pages 639-646) and index.

Introduction -- Language design criteria -- Functional programming -- Logic programming -- Object-oriented programming -- Syntax -- Basic semantics -- Data types -- Control I -- Expressions and statements -- Control II -- Procedures and environments -- Abstract data types and modules -- Formal semantics -- Parallel programming.

"Kenneth Louden and Kenneth Lambert's new edition of Programming languages: principles and practice gives advanced undergraduate students an overview of programming languages through general principles combined with details about many modern languages. Major languages used in this edition include C, C++, Smalltalk, Java, Ada, ML, Haskell, Scheme, and Prolog; many other languages are discussed more briefly. The text also contains extensive coverage of implementation issues, the theoretical foundations of programming languages, and a large number of exercises, making it the perfect bridge to compiler courses and to the theoretical study of programming languages."--Publisher's description."

There are no comments on this title.

to post a comment.